What types of positions does Langford Staffing fill in Largo?
We place workers in hospitality, warehouse, light industrial, skilled trades, healthcare, IT, and office roles. We handle temp staffing for short-term coverage, contract staffing for defined projects, and permanent placement when you are hiring for keeps. If you need a forklift operator, a line cook, a medical assistant, or an accounts payable clerk, we find and screen candidates who fit your requirements.
How quickly can Langford provide workers in Largo?
For temp and contract roles, we often place candidates within 24 to 48 hours if the role matches our active pipeline. Permanent placement searches typically take one to three weeks depending on the seniority and specialization of the position. We keep a roster of pre-screened local candidates so we can move fast when you have an urgent need.
Does Langford Staffing handle payroll and onboarding for temporary workers?
Yes. For every temp and contract placement, we manage payroll, tax withholding, workers' compensation insurance, and onboarding paperwork. You supervise the work, and we handle the administrative burden. When you convert a temp worker to permanent, we coordinate the transition so nothing falls through the cracks.
